  • Patent number: 9657727
    Abstract: A water amusement and hydration bicycle can include a bicycle frame and a container to contain water carried by the bicycle frame, the container having an outlet port and a multipurpose port. The bicycle can also include an amusement nozzle removably coupled to the outlet port. The bicycle can further include a drinking nozzle removably coupleable to the multipurpose port. The bicycle can still further include a water pump carried by the bicycle frame and operable to pump the water from the container through the outlet port for delivery to the amusement nozzle. In addition, the bicycle can include a gas pump operable to pressurize gas in the container to move the water from the container through the multipurpose port for delivery to the drinking nozzle when the drinking nozzle is coupled to the multipurpose port. The multipurpose port can be coupleable to a water source to provide water to the container.

  • Publication number: 20160337548
    Abstract: Systems and methods for capturing and sharing content are disclosed. Including capturing content data related to a scene via an image capturing device. Further including, capturing identifying data from a beacon via a sensor associated with the image capturing device wherein the identifying data identifies an artifact in the scene. Further including, binding the identifying data to the content data at the image capturing device such that the artifact may be subsequently identified in the content data. Further including, sending the identifying data and the content data, bound together, to a content server.

  • Patent number: 8730388
    Abstract: A digital imaging device includes at least two image sensors carried by a body and having image axes oriented transverse to one another and facing in different directions transverse to one another. The image sensors are rotatable with respect to the body and each have a rotational axis parallel with a respective corresponding image axis. Each image sensor has an upright physical orientation corresponding to an upright orientation of the optical image and is capable of rotation about the rotational axis to orient the image sensor in the upright orientation.
